Guest Posted May 19, 2006 Report Share Posted May 19, 2006 Hello! I'm a newbie and an having a problem with repeating entries. Some of my repeating entries need to be overridden by holidays. Is there any way to show this override? Currently both the regular entry and the holiday entry are displayed, but it would be cleaner if somehow the regular entry could be removed. Jill Posted May 20, 2006 Report Share Posted May 20, 2006 The best way to do this would be to: 1. Go to the List view of your calendar in Trumba 2. Select the check boxes for the instances that are overridden by holidays. 3. Use the drop-down list at the top of the calendar to delete the selected instances. This does not affect other instances of the recurring event. The drawback is that it might be a little time consuming to select them all over several years. But it's definitely faster than the other option, which is to open each instance of the recurring event that you want to delete and clicking the Delete this Event button.
